Output 3d1381b2863966992ef26c642df63bd551d69da3b3237e14cc09e9afafb6949b:20

value
370046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c3a3ed79022a15ead9a17e1bdaa2fc1a6eac87b OP_EQUAL
address
3JrGjaH26WF52NoRxYT79EJPcZ2UZ5nadX
transaction
3d1381b2863966992ef26c642df63bd551d69da3b3237e14cc09e9afafb6949b
spent
true